The aramid fiber market for automotive hoses was valued at US$ 1,27,418.10 thousand in 2021 and is projected to reach US$ 2,13,935.94 thousand by 2028; it is expected to grow at a CAGR of 7.7% from 2021 to 2028. Aramid fiber is a man-made polymer belonging to the class of strong synthetic and heat-resistant fibers. They provide good resistance to abrasion and organic solvents, and exhibit high melting point, low conductivity, and low flammability. There has been an increase in the use of aramid fibers in the automotive industry in applications such as tires, turbocharger hoses, powertrain components, belts, brake pads, gaskets, clutches, seat fabrics, electronics, seat sensors, and hybrid motor materials. These fibers are used to reinforce transmission, radiator, and turbocharger hoses. The hoses that are reinforced with aramid fibers are stronger and long-lasting and can withstand the toughest conditions.

Based on type, the aramid fiber market for automotive hoses is segmented into para-aramid fiber and meta-aramid fiber. The para-aramids fiber segment dominated the market in 2020. Para-aramids have high tensile strength (the highest stress that a material can withstand) and modulus behavior (the tendency of a material to deform when force is applied). The dry-jet, wet spinning method is used to make these fibers, which results in fiber with completely extended liquid crystal chains generated along the fiber axis and a high degree of crystallinity, which adds to the fiber's strength. P-aramid fibers can be made with a tenacity of 23 g/den and a break elongation of 3.5%. Compared to meta-aramid polyamide, fibers manufactured from para-aramid polyamide exhibit a greater strength. Para-aramid fibers are used to make reinforcement polymers for civil constructions, stress skin panels, and other high-tensile-strength applications.
